Exposure to damp and moldy environments may cause a variety of health effects, or none at all. Some people are sensitive to molds. For these people, exposure to molds can lead to symptoms such as stuffy nose, wheezing, and red or itchy eyes, or skin. Some people, such as those with allergies to molds or with … See more Molds are very common in buildings and homes. Mold will grow in places with a lot of moisture, such as around leaks in roofs, windows, or pipes, or … See more People with allergies may be more sensitive to molds. People with immune suppression or underlying lung disease are more susceptible … See more Mold is found both indoors and outdoors. Mold can enter your home through open doorways, windows, vents, and heating and air conditioning systems. WebApr 18, 2024 · They are classified as toxins because even at very low doses, they can cause ill effects or even death in humans and other animals. [ ref] They differ from the toxins found in poisonous mushrooms (which are the fruiting bodies of fungi).
